## Ownership

The telemetry compression layer in Pondrel now batches payloads before applying dictionary-based compression, cutting average upload size by roughly 60%. Config lives in the collector module; defaults are tuned for the Varn fleet and should not be changed without a load test. Questions about codec selection, batching windows, or the fallback path should go through the component owner. The person responsible for this area is listed below.

approver of yawig-yajef = Briius Jorix

/*
 * HERMETIC_MIGRATION_BASELINE
 *
 * New team members: this constant pins the last verified artifact from the
 * legacy Makefile build before we migrated Spindlecraft to the hermetic
 * Foundry pipeline. Do not update it casually — it is the comparison anchor
 * used by the parity checker, which diffs legacy and hermetic outputs on
 * every merge. If parity breaks, bisect toolchain inputs first; network
 * fetches are the usual culprit. The pinned baseline is identified by the
 * token on the following line.
 */

build token for kagaf-hahof: htk14_9d3d4d26d7d8de

Finance Review Summary — FX Hedging

Q2 exposure to the Arlenne franc rose 18% on the Dorsey Fabrication contract. Unhedged position cost us roughly 2.1% of unit margin last quarter. Decision: hedge 70% of twelve-month projected flows using rolling three-month forwards; remainder stays open. Options considered and rejected on premium cost. Treasury executes from next week; review monthly. Variance reporting moves to the standard pack. A confidential note on related business plans is appended below.

internal memo for kawip-hadug: Headcount on the Wenwyn team goes from 7 to 140 by the end of January. Gross margin on Wenwyn came in at 20 percent against a plan of 15 percent.